Biturbo and VXR alloys have polished spoke fronts, if they are scratched up they cost a lot for refurbishment as leaving them causes corrosion. So, you can go for 20's that are probably marked up with decent tread or 19" new refurbished with new tyres. On a 5 dr J I reckon 19's offer the best option of style & comfort over 20's. The price of tyres has to be taken into consideration also with 19's generally being the cheaper option.

(13:th-Apr-2017, 12:11:28) ronnierae Wrote: Hi Tonto, mods look good mate, Im fitting my foot well lights in this weekend, where did you splice in for the live?...also where did you get your white touch up stick?
Cheers
Ronnie
Thanks mate
There is a how to on here mate, I used the loom that is behind glovebox that goes up the A pillar. Splice into the thickest grey wire (should be 3 grey wires) and then a black wire for ground.
Touch up pen was just of eBay. Around £7-8 iirc.
